1 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ER POPULATION SIZE ESTIMATES 10 December 2009 Heritage Hotel Manila N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ER

2 MSM E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1*7% of total adult male population Estimate 2*6% of total adult male population Estimate 3*5% of total adult male population Estimate 4*4% of total adult male population Estimate 5*3% of total adult male population Estimate 6*2% of total adult male population Estimate 7*1% of total adult male population Estimate 8STIR UP Vulnerability Index *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country

3 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ER Registered FSW E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1Actual reported number of RFSW at the SHC in 2009 Estimate 2STIR UP: Vulnerability Index Estimate 3*2007 Estimates: 0.3% of total adult female population Estimate 4a*Asian Models: High estimate 2.6% of total adult female population Estimate 4b*Asian Models: Low estimate 0.2% of total adult female population Estimate 5a*Using the proportion of RFSW (as reported by SHC) in total female population: Median Proportion – 1.07% Estimate 5b*Using the proportion of RFSW (as reported by SHC) in total female population: Low Proportion – 0.12% *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country

4 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ER Freelance FSW E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1IHBSS Multiplier: Visited the SHC in the past year Estimate 2STIR UP: Low FSW Estimate Estimate 3STIR UP: Vulnerability Index Estimate 4a*2007 Estimates: High Estimate 0.5% of total adult female population Estimate 4b*2007 Estimates: Low Estimate 0.3% of total adult female population Estimate 5a*Asian Models: High estimate 2.6% of total adult female population Estimate 5b*Asian Models: Low estimate 0.2% of total adult female population Estimate 6a*Using the proportion of Freelance FSW in total female population: Median proportion – 0.5% Estimate 6b*Using the proportion of Freelance FSW in total female population: Low proportion – 0.023% *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country

5 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ER Total FSW E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1Total Registered + Total Freelance Sex Workers Estimate 2STIR UP: High FSW Estimate Estimate 3STIR UP: Vulnerability Index Estimate 4a*2007 Estimates: High Estimate 0.9% of total adult female population Estimate 4b*2007 Estimates: Low Estimate 0.6% of total adult female population Estimate 5a*Asian Models: High estimate 2.6% of total adult female population Estimate 5b*Asian Models: Low estimate 0.2% of total adult female population *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country

6 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ER Clients of FSW E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1IHBSS: Average # of clients per month of RFLW x estimated total # of RFSW + Average # of clients per month of FLSW x estimated total # of FLSW Estimate 2a*2007 Estimates: High Estimate 7% of total adult male population Estimate 2b*2007 Estimates: Average Estimate 4.5% of total adult male population Estimate 2c*2007 Estimates: Low Estimate 2% of total adult female population Estimate 3a*Total # of clients in IHBSS sites + 2007 High estimate (7%) Estimate 3b*Total # of clients in IHBSS sites + 2007 Average estimate (4.5%) Estimate 3c*Total # of clients in IHBSS sites + 2007 Low estimate (2%) *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country

7 NATIONAL EPIDEMIOLOGY CENTER Injecting Drug Users EstimatesSource of the Estimated Number Estimate 1IHBSS: % ever injected drugs among RegFSW x total estimated # of RFSW + % ever injected drugs among FreelanceFSW x total est # of FLSW + % ever injected drugs among MSM x total est # of MSM + Estimated number of IDU in Cebu, GenSan & Zamboanga Estimate 2STIR UP: Vulnerability Index Estimate 3a*2007 Estimates: High Estimate 0.05% of total adult population Estimate 3b*2007 Estimates: Low Estimate 0.02% of total adult population Estimate 4a*Using the proportion of Estimate 3a or 3b in IHBSS sites: Median proportion – 0.042% Estimate 4b*Using the proportion of Estimate 3a or 3b in IHBSS sites: Low proportion – 0.0178% *Estimate can be applied for the rest of the country
